Design and Comfort
The Gabit Smart Ring boasts a premium titanium build, making it both durable and lightweight. Weighing just 3.1 grams, it offers a comfortable fit, making it suitable for long-term wear without discomfort.
The ring measures 8mm in width and 2.7mm in thickness, ensuring it doesn’t feel bulky or intrusive during everyday activities. Users can choose from three color options—Matte Black, Silver, and Gold, providing a stylish look that complements both casual and professional attire.
Additionally, with a 5ATM water resistance rating, users can wear it during workouts, showers, and light water-based activities without worrying about damage. This durability enhances its appeal for fitness enthusiasts and professionals who want round-the-clock health monitoring.
Sizing and Fit
To ensure an accurate fit, Gabit provides a dedicated sizing kit with multiple size options ranging from 6 to 13. Since proper fit is crucial for accurate health tracking, the company recommends wearing the ring on the index finger for optimal performance.
Comprehensive Health and Fitness Tracking
The Gabit Smart Ring integrates several advanced sensors that enable real-time health monitoring, including:
- PPG Sensor: Tracks heart rate and blood oxygen levels (SpO2).
- Skin Temperature Sensor: Monitors changes in body temperature.
- 3D Accelerometer: Measures physical activity, step count, and motion patterns.
These sensors enable users to monitor multiple health metrics, including:
- Step count and activity tracking
- Workout intensity and duration
- Sleep patterns, including deep sleep and REM cycles
- Heart rate and heart rate variability (HRV)
- Blood oxygen levels (SpO2) and stress levels
- VO2 max readings for aerobic fitness
Unlike smartwatches that display real-time data, the Gabit Smart Ring relies on its companion mobile app to provide users with detailed insights.
Gabit Smart Ring Companion App
The Gabit app serves as the central hub for all tracked health data. The user-friendly interface categorizes data into five main sections:
- Home: Displays an overview of key health metrics, including sleep, stress, activity, and nutrition.
- Smart Ring: Offers in-depth analysis of heart rate, sleep quality, and stress levels.
- Fitness: Tracks workouts and physical activity, providing real-time insights into calorie burn and endurance.
- Nutrition: Allows users to log meals and monitor calorie intake, categorizing food into carbohydrates, fats, proteins, and fiber.
- Skincare: Provides insights into how lifestyle habits impact skin health, making it a unique addition to the health tracking experience.
The app presents data through easy-to-read graphs and trend reports, helping users understand patterns and make informed health decisions.
Nutrition and Diet Tracking
One of Gabit’s standout features is its built-in nutrition tracking system, allowing users to log their daily meals and calorie intake through:
- Voice input
- Manual text entry
While the voice feature is still being refined to recognize a wider range of food items, manual input remains a reliable option for accurate tracking. Users can categorize meals as breakfast, lunch, snacks, or dinner, and the app offers personalized diet recommendations based on nutrient intake and fitness goals.
Performance and Accuracy
The Gabit Smart Ring delivers highly accurate health tracking that rivals some of the best smartwatches in the market. Side-by-side comparisons with leading wearables, such as the Google Pixel Watch 3, revealed minimal discrepancies in step count, heart rate, and SpO2 levels.
- Step count: Differences were typically within one or two steps between devices.
- Heart rate: Variations remained within 1-2 beats per minute, ensuring precision in monitoring cardiac activity.
- Blood oxygen (SpO2) readings: Showed reliable results when compared with medical-grade pulse oximeters.
These findings indicate that the Gabit Smart Ring can match the accuracy of premium fitness trackers while offering a more compact and non-intrusive form factor.
Battery Life and Charging
A major highlight of the Gabit Smart Ring is its exceptional battery life. The ring charges fully in under two hours using a compact USB Type-C charging case and lasts up to 10 days on a single charge.
This extended battery life gives it a distinct advantage over smartwatches, which require frequent recharging. Users can track their health continuously without worrying about daily battery management.
